MobCapture Capture & Release Mobs

MobCapture is a small add-on that lets you capture mobs into a portable item and release them later. It is simple to use and craftable with common materials.

 

How to capture

  1. Hold a Capture Orb in your hand.
  2. Throw it at a mob (use / right-click / tap). If the capture succeeds the mob is removed and you will receive a Release Orb.

How to release

  1. Select the Release Orb in your hotbar.
  2. Use it (press use / right-click / tap). The stored mob will spawn near you with a short particle effect.

Crafting

Place 1 Ender Pearl in the center of the crafting grid and surround it with 8 Glass. The recipe produces 4 Capture Orbs.

Craft recipe

[   ] [ G ] [   ]
[ G ] [ E ] [ G ]
[   ] [ G ] [   ]

Where: G = Glass, E = Ender Pearl

Commands (testing)

/give @s mobcapture:mob_capture_orb 4
/give @s mobcapture:mob_release_orb 1
